What is Medical Coding?
Medical coding is the process of converting medical data, such as diseases, medical equipment, or any medical procedure, into alphanumeric codes. These codes help insurance companies process claims accurately and enable healthcare providers to maintain standardized patient records.
Coders use classification systems such as ICD-10 (International Classification of Diseases), CPT (Current Procedural Terminology), and HCPCS (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System). These are essential for efficient billing and reimbursement.

Medical Coding Salary Overview
So, what can one expect in terms of compensation?
1. Medical Coding Salary in India
The medical coding salary in India can vary based on experience, qualifications, location, and the type of employer. Here’s a general breakdown:
Experience Level | Monthly Salary (INR) | Annual Salary (INR) |
Fresher (0–1 year) | ₹15,000 – ₹25,000 | ₹1.8 – ₹3.0 LPA |
1–3 Years | ₹25,000 – ₹40,000 | ₹3.0 – ₹5.0 LPA |
3–5 Years | ₹40,000 – ₹60,000 | ₹5.0 – ₹7.5 LPA |
5+ Years / Team Lead | ₹60,000 – ₹90,000 | ₹7.5 – ₹10 LPA |
Tier-1 cities such as Bangalore, Hyderabad, and Chennai tend to offer higher packages due to the presence of major healthcare outsourcing firms and international hospital chains.
2. Medical Coding Salary Globally
Certified professional coders can earn more globally in the United States, the average salary for a certified medical coder ranges from $45,000 to $65,000 per year. Those with certifications like CPC (Certified Professional Coder) or CCS (Certified Coding Specialist) often earn more.
Factors That Influence Salary
Several factors affect the medical coding salary in India:
- Certifications: Holding an international certification like AAPC’s CPC or AHIMA’s CCS can significantly boost salary.
- Experience: Like most professions, more experience means a better salary.
- Specialization – Coders specialized in areas like anaesthesia, cardiology, or orthopaedics often earn more.
- Employer Type – BPOs, multi-specialty hospitals, and international clients usually pay higher.
- Location – Salaries in metro cities tend to be higher than in tier-2 or tier-3 cities.
Getting Started: Medical Coding Training
Before diving into the job market, the first step is completing a medical coding training program. These courses are designed to teach students about:
- Anatomy and physiology
- Medical terminologies
- 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S coding systems
- HIPAA and healthcare compliance standards
Training can be done both online and offline, depending on your availability and learning preference.

Importance of Medical Coding Certification Online
While anyone can learn coding basics, having a medical coding certification online from a recognized body enhances employability and earning potential. Certifications like:
- CPC (Certified Professional Coder) from AAPC
- CCA (Certified Coding Associate) or CCS (Certified Coding Specialist) from AHIMA
These certifications are globally recognized and often mandatory for high-paying medical coding jobs.
Career Path and Growth Opportunities
Medical coding is not just a job, it can be a rewarding career path. Here is a typical growth trajectory:
- Junior Medical Coder – Entry-level position for freshers
- Medical Coding Specialist – After 1–3 years with added specialization
- Quality Analyst or Auditor – Responsible for reviewing coded data
- Team Lead / Coding Manager – Overseeing teams and ensuring accuracy
- Trainer / Consultant – Conduct training sessions or consult with clients
Some experienced professionals also move into medical billing, compliance auditing, or clinical documentation improvement roles.
